KINGSTON, Jamaica – The Jamaica Premier League is anticipated to renew on Wednesday following the strike motion by referees that noticed the postponement of the primary set of video games within the third spherical of the competitors, set for Sunday and Monday.
A launch from Skilled Soccer Jamaica Restricted (PFJL) – organisers of the competition- on Tuesday, stated the problems that had precipitated the video games to be postponed have been “resolved” and the competitors would resume with one sport on Wednesday and 6 on Thursday.
“The Jamaica Premier League is the heartbeat of soccer in our nation, impacting numerous lives and livelihoods. We lengthen our honest apologies to the followers and all these affected by the postponements final match weekend. Relaxation assured, we’re dedicated to making sure such interruptions don’t reoccur,” Chris Williams, chairman of PFJL, was quoted within the launch to have stated.
Jamaica Soccer Federation (JFF) president Michael Ricketts and Valdin Ledgister, president of the Jamaica Soccer Referees Affiliation ((JFRA), had been additionally quoted within the launch expressing their delight within the decision of the problems and the following restart of the competitors.
It’s understood that the match officers stayed away from video games set for Sunday and Monday as that they had not acquired cost for video games carried out within the first two rounds of the competitors.
Stories are that “just below $8 million” was owed to the referees.
